Glen Burnie 7-Eleven Robbed at Gunpoint

Charlie Dwyer

GLEN BURNIE, MD – On Wednesday, police here said a black male subject wearing a black mask, jean pants and black sneakers held up the 7-Eleven on Crain Highway.

According to police, at approximately 12:00 a.m., officers responded for a report of a robbery that just occurred at the 7-Eleven at 1250 Crain Highway South in Glen Burnie.

“Employees on the scene reported a suspect entered the business, jumped the counter, displayed a handgun, and demanded money,” police said. “The suspect took cash and fled the area on foot.

Commercial Robbery Unit Detectives are investigating and ask anyone with any information to call 410-222-4720 or the Anne Arundel County Police Tip-Line at (410) 222-4700.
